What is the role of the brain stem in the nervous system?

The brain stem plays a crucial role in the nervous system as it serves as a vital pathway for impulses traveling between the brain and the spinal cord. This structure connects various parts of the brain to the rest of the body, allowing for communication of sensory information and motor commands. It is responsible for regulating many automatic functions of the body, such as breathing and heart rate, as it integrates signals from higher brain centers and relays them to the peripheral nervous system.

This connectivity is essential for maintaining homeostasis and coordinating basic life-sustaining functions. The brain stem includes structures such as the midbrain, pons, and medulla oblongata, each contributing to this pathway and to the processing of vital information that keeps bodily functions operating smoothly.
